TDF – “Culture” review

TDF is a 21 year old producer from Minnesota who emerged in 2020 off his debut EP TDF & Friends and the sequel marking his full-length debut studio LP. He later followed it up with next EP EP Patient 0 as well as the sophomore effort I Love You & the final entry of the TDF & Friends trilogy, I Love You later spawning a 2nd & a 3rd installment with Religion bridging both sequels. It’s been a while since Blueprint & love4you, shaping his 9th album in front of us to be his biggest one ever.

“need some more” by Okaymar is this cloudy trap intro talking about his neck floodin’ & this bitch giving him throat whereas “been too long” by Omgkeon continues the trillwave vibes flexing that he’s stronger than ever after going through some pain. “still my patna” by ATL Smook goes for more of a plugg direction instrumentally to talk about the scammers, trappers & robbers he knows leasing into “attached” by Jojo discussing a woman who he feels can change his life.

Spoof get his own song with “bankroll” promising on his whole entire squad that he’s gonna be the one who’ll snatch your chain, but then “1 for me” by NYM Riz gets back on the plugg tip telling the specific woman he has in mind that she’s his soulmate. “numb” by Jssr samples “Novacane” by Frank Ocean nothing away from the way these good drugs got him feeling while “stamped” by 1oneam talks about already being official.

“ghetto symphony” by ohsxnta maintains a plugg edge to the beat boasting that he’s come a long way & having too much swag just before “bands gone” by Jojo, omgkeon & Spoof unites the trio on top of this crazy Angry Birds flip getting high to hide the emotions. “rave” by BenjiCold continues to bare a plugg influence talking about balling out & liking to dance with his girl while “water” by Dom Corleo warns people to stop flexing as if they meant something.

Thr33 & wildkarduno link up on the 2-parter “out of kontrol / paparazzi” telling the fuck boys they’re gonna be shot on sight along with coming out the mud as if they were pigs while “cassava leaf” by Thr33 holds the fort down by himself talking about the money being green & preaching over the instrumental. “yo lane” by wildkarduno discusses the plug being late shooting like the Los Angeles Clippers & “bta” by Smokingskul sticks out since it recaptures the dark plugg energy of what makes this duo gel greatly.

“used to be” by Smokingskul & wildkarduno delves further deep into the evil plugg sound feeling like Facebook founder & Meta Platforms CEO Mark Zuckerberg as well as calling for Luigi Mangione’s freedom since they consider him a real one while “Fried” by Okaymar tones down the darkness in favor of a general plugg flare cautions that’s exactly what will happen if you even try to run up on him while “what you said” by Okaymar & 1oneam talks about not hearing what you say since they smoke loud.

Pasto Flocco delivers another standout performance with “swervo” cloudily breaking down the streets being cold & a woman wanting to kick it with him prior to “late night drinks” & face card” showcasing both Okaymar & 1oneam’s chemistry for the final time. “make it work” by ohsxnta remains optimistic of his music career sorting itself out in his favor & the closer “hope you know” by 1oneam advises that success is the loudest response to those who ever doubted you.

Skul was one of the first dark plugg artists that I got into when I started listening to the subgenre & TDF has laced some of his most popular songs, which was a reason why I gave Culture a listen & it sure enough is his most enjoyable solo effort in his discography. His production centered around plugg, dark plugg, cloud rap & trap is some of the strongest that he’s crafted with the varied list of underground trap performers laying down their unique styles stronger than previously.

Score: 4/5
